Inevitable really. The fixture list is just too crowded for the big boys at this time of year. Pity for the minnows though, who earn a draw at home and then get the chance to take a major club, like Manchester United to a replay at Old Trafford. Massive earner for a small club. Can and has been the difference between life and death for a club close to bankruptcy.
